In 1951, Mr. Ready a well-off property owner gifted his exuberance piece of land to Acharya Bhave for the movement of Bhoodan, after that Pochmpally also named as Bhoodan Pochampally. This is the hub of Ikkat design sarees remarkable for hand woven geometrical patterns done by skilled weavers.
